Arrow <<< If You Are Going To Track Event #6 To Race Or Watch Read Me >>>>

Here are a few things you need to know before getting to the track on Saturday.

The track has a normal test and tune earlier on the same morning so when you get there you may see a few cars in already or even possibly still running depending on how busy they were. Please do not arrive prior to 3:00 so you are not in the way of people trying to leave.

When you get to the gate you will either pay $30 if you are already on the pre-register list or $40 if you are not. Keep in mind there are only 15-20 spots left to purchase at the gate and as I have told the thousands of people that want one of them it is first come first served. However if the lines are moving well after we start the race we will make a announcement that there are X amount of spots now open, it all depends. We have these Track Events to have minimal wait time so I am not going to jeprodize that.

There is NO LIMIT on spectators and the cost is $5.00. The TRack Events are as much a social event as they are a race so come out and enjoy even if you do not race. If you are just spectating please DO NOT PARK ON OR NEAR THE STAGING LANES. Park by the fence near the track or in the grass median.

As a added bonus there should be several professional NHRA Pro Stock cars (running in the 6's) at the track doing some testing, they may or may not stick around for the evening we will see. But I do have some 8 second cars coming for sure.

Please drive smart coming down 64 to the track and especially when you leave.

When coming through the front gate we will have a TR donation box set-up for server and software upgrades that we are looking to get, please throw in a few bucks if you can.

The proper safety equipment will be required so if you do not know what that is I suggest you find out by calling the track (941) 748-1320.

Also do not DRIVE THROUGH THE WATERBOX AT THE STARTING LINE unless you are FWD and are running slicks, otherwise RWD cars need to go around and back up. Dragging water on the track by driving through it makes the traction go away quick !

Most importantly have fun and be smart when at the track.
